Hey tempers,
So I've been having an issue with my Wii U gamepad's left analog stick in that its slow to respond when pushing up or down.
Left and right are functioning perfectly, but when I want it to go up I have to push it all the way and even then there is delay of about a second. Same with controlling down.
Wondering if anyone has had this issue or would know what is going on and how to fix it.

How to Reset the Left/Right Stick(s) to a Neutral Position on the Wii U GamePad
Applies to: Wii U Deluxe, Wii U Basic

Step by step instructions on resetting the Wii U GamePad L/R Stick(s) to a neutral position.

Information:
The neutral position of the control sticks can be incorrectly set if you move them during the following actions:

  • Turning the console on
  • Launching software
  • Quitting software and returning to the Wii U Menu
What to Do:
  1. Press the POWER button on the Wii U GamePad to turn on the console.
  2. Allow the control sticks to return to a neutral untouched position.
    IL-62-EN.jpg

  3. Simultaneously hold down the A Button, B Button, + Button, and - Button for at least 3 seconds.
    • There will be no indication when the recalibration is complete.

I have the same problem. Apparently even without much usage the analog degrade with time.
I had to buy a set of replacements on Amazon.
The good news is they are quite affordable and the Wii U gamepad is modular so its very easy to replace them.
